Message type: E = Error
Message class: OST_BSDM - Web Service BOL Service Data Management
Message number: 016
Message text: &1 is not a root object or an access object

- &1 is not a root object or an access object ?The SAP error message OST_BSDM016 indicates that the object you are trying to access or manipulate is neither a root object nor an access object. This error typically arises in the context of Business Object Processing Framework (BOPF) or when dealing with Business Object Data Model (BODM) in SAP.
Cause:
- Incorrect Object Type: The object you are trying to work with is not defined as a root object or access object in the system. Root objects are the main entities in the data model, while access objects are used to access or manipulate data related to these root objects.
- Configuration Issues: There may be a misconfiguration in the Business Object or the data model that leads to the system not recognizing the object as valid.
- Authorization Issues: Sometimes, the user may not have the necessary authorizations to access the object, leading to this error.
- Data Model Changes: If there have been recent changes to the data model or the business object definitions, it may lead to inconsistencies.
Solution:
- Check Object Definition: Verify that the object you are trying to access is correctly defined as a root object or access object in the Business Object Model. You can do this by checking the configuration in the SAP system.
- Review Configuration: Ensure that the configuration for the Business Object is correct. This includes checking the object types, relationships, and any associated access objects.
- Authorization Check: Make sure that the user has the necessary authorizations to access the object. You can check the user roles and authorizations in the SAP system.
- Debugging: If you have access to the development environment, you can debug the code to see where the error is being triggered and gather more context about the object being accessed.
- Consult Documentation: Refer to SAP documentation or notes related to the specific business object you are working with for any known issues or additional configuration steps.
- Contact SAP Support: If the issue persists and you cannot find a resolution, consider reaching out to SAP support for assistance.
